URL: https://github.com/freeipa/freeipa/pull/3323
Author: serg-cymbaluk
Title: #3323: [Backport][ipa-4-6] WebUI: Fix 'user not found' traceback on user ID override details page
Action: opened
PR body:
"""
This PR was opened automatically because PR #3261 was pushed to master and backport to ipa-4-6 is required.
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3323/head:pr3323
git checkout pr3323
URL: https://github.com/freeipa/freeipa/pull/3324
Author: serg-cymbaluk
Title: #3324: [Backport][ipa-4-7] WebUI: Fix 'user not found' traceback on user ID override details page
Action: opened
PR body:
"""
This PR was opened automatically because PR #3261 was pushed to master and backport to ipa-4-7 is required.
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3324/head:pr3324
git checkout pr3324
URL: https://github.com/freeipa/freeipa/pull/3261
Author: serg-cymbaluk
Title: #3261: WebUI: Fix 'user not found' traceback on user ID override details page
Action: opened
PR body:
"""
Disable link to user page from user ID override in case it is in 'Default Trust View'
Ticket: https://pagure.io/freeipa/issue/7139
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3261/head:pr3261
git checkout pr3261
URL: https://github.com/freeipa/freeipa/pull/3280
Author: stanislavlevin
Title: #3280: Exit on fail in azure multiline script
Action: opened
PR body:
"""
By default, the `last` exit code returned from Azure script will be
checked and, if non-zero, treated as a step failure. Luckily,
for Linux script is a shortcut for Bash. Hence errexit/e option
could be applied. But Azure pipelines doesn't set it by default:
https://github.com/microsoft/azure-pipelines-agent/issues/1803
For multiline script this is a problem unless otherwise designed.
Some of the benefits of checking the result of each subcommand:
- preventing subsequent issues (broken packages, container images, etc.)
- time saving (next steps will not run)
- good diagnostics (tells which part of the script fails)
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3280/head:pr3280
git checkout pr3280
URL: https://github.com/freeipa/freeipa/pull/3320
Author: tiran
Title: #3320: [Backport][ipa-4-7] ipa-client-automount: fix '--idmap-domain DNS' logic
Action: opened
PR body:
"""
This PR was opened automatically because PR #3300 was pushed to master and backport to ipa-4-7 is required.
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3320/head:pr3320
git checkout pr3320
URL: https://github.com/freeipa/freeipa/pull/3319
Author: tiran
Title: #3319: [Backport][ipa-4-7] adtrust upgrade: fix wrong primary principal name
Action: opened
PR body:
"""
This PR was opened automatically because PR #3312 was pushed to master and backport to ipa-4-7 is required.
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3319/head:pr3319
git checkout pr3319
URL: https://github.com/freeipa/freeipa/pull/3318
Author: tiran
Title: #3318: [Backport][ipa-4-6] adtrust upgrade: fix wrong primary principal name
Action: opened
PR body:
"""
This PR was opened automatically because PR #3312 was pushed to master and backport to ipa-4-6 is required.
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3318/head:pr3318
git checkout pr3318
URL: https://github.com/freeipa/freeipa/pull/3312
Author: abbra
Title: #3312: adtrust upgrade: fix wrong primary principal name
Action: opened
PR body:
"""
Upgrade code had Kerberos principal names mixed up: instead of creating
krbtgt/LOCAL-FLAT@REMOTE and marking LOCAL-FLAT$@REMOTE as an alias to
it, it created LOCAL-FLAT$@REMOTE Kerberos principal and marked
krbtgt/LOCAL-FLAT@REMOTE as an alias.
This differs from what Active Directory expects and what is created by
ipasam plugin when trust is established. When upgrading such deployment,
an upgrade code then unexpectedly failed.
Resolves: https://pagure.io/freeipa/issue/7992
"""
To pull the PR as Git branch:
git remote add ghfreeipa https://github.com/freeipa/freeipa
git fetch ghfreeipa pull/3312/head:pr3312
git checkout pr3312